Aucklander imprisoned for 35 days after cocaine bust returns home. A Kiwi male model has returned home after five weeks in a Japanese jail for trying to run from police who found him with cocaine.
Kieran Price, of Orewa, was arrested during a random search in Tokyo in July. He was carrying 0.2g of the drug.
The 25-year-old, who featured
in the 2010 Cleo Bachelor of the Year competition, was reaching celebrity status in Japan after appearing in a TV advertisement for water.
His mother, Amanda Bennett, says the 35 days he spent behind bars was a life-changing experience.
